HomeMy WebLinkAboutRES 412 Draft 01 1988-1992COUNTY OF HAWAfl STATE OF HAWAII RESOLUTION N0. 41~ 92 WHEREAS, Article V, Section 5-1.3(c) of the Hawaii County Charter states that the Mayor has the power to "Create positions...for which appropriations have been made by the council..."; and WHEREAS, each year for the last several years, an increase in the number of police officers have resulted in adding to the burden of the Office of the Prosecuting Attorney such as more recruit classes scheduled, additional phone calls requesting advice, and increased referrals to the office; and WHEREAS, the existing staff of attorneys bears a caseload considerably higher than normal or ideal whereby previously simple tasks have become complex with the multitude of reports that the police are now able to investigate and refer; and WHEREAS, an additional Deputy Prosecuting Attorney, LG-O1 and a Legal Stenographer, SR-14 would help to alleviate the burden of the burgeoning caseload; and WHEREAS, the Office of the Prosecuting Attorney has funds available in its Regular Salaries and Wages account. N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ED HY THE COUNCIL OF THE COUNTY OF HAWAII that one (1) Deputy Prosecuting Attorney, LG-O1, position and one (1) Legal Stenographer, SR-14, position be created and that funds are available in the Regular Salaries and Wages account of the Office of the Prosecuting Attorney. BE IT FURTHER RESOLVED that a copy of this resolution be transmitted to the Office of the Prosecuting Office and the Departments of Finance and Civil Service. Dated at Hilo, Hawaii, this 5th day of March 1992.
